'Tribal Rage'
[PC] [USA] [MAGAZINE, TEASER] [1998]
"Long known for their serious wargames, TalonSoft is still going in a serious directionโseriously different for them, that isโwith Tribal Rage, a real-time strategy title due out this Spring. Set in the year 2030, the story is a mixture of Mad Max-style post-apocalypticism and Redneck Rampage over-the-top characterization. Earth is depleted and civilization is toast; all that's left are bands of the usual riff-raff: Bikers, Cyborgs, Amazons, Enforcers, those tiresome Death Cultists, and "gold ol' Trailer Trash." It's be your job to lead one of these bands of yahoos (except you're advised to never call your Death Cultists yahoos) through either a campaign game or sets of scenarios. The campaign is linked scenarios, but unlike most other real-time strategy games TalonSoft says it's different each time a new campaign is started. The scenarios recreate the rivalries present in the game's universe, so expect to see, for example, Bikers going up against the Enforcers (police remnants). The game will include a complete scenario/tribe editor that will let you build your own game experience from the vehicles up; TalonSoft is already planning an add-on CD with a set of new tribes. Up to six players can fight it out in multiplayer, either via LAN, Internet, or head-to-dead." ~Scott Udell, Computer Games Strategy Plus (#88, March 1998)
